About this place
We are pleased to present an exceptional villa for sale in Ibiza, distinguished by its privileged location, expansive living spaces, and complete privacy. Ideally situated just five minutes from Ibiza Town and the international airport, as well as a short drive from Playa d’en Bossa and the renowned beach of Sa Caleta, this residence offers a perfect balance of tranquillity, comfort, and convenient access to some of the island’s most sought-after destinations.
Set on an impressive 7,000 m² plot, a rare find in this highly desirable area, the property boasts around 610 m² of built area, surrounded by beautifully landscaped Mediterranean gardens, mature palm trees, and various fruit trees including orange, lemon, fig, almond, and carob. The villa comprises five spacious bedrooms, with the ground floor featuring four bedrooms, all equipped with air conditioning and large windows that seamlessly connect the interior with outdoor spaces. Two full bathrooms and a guest cloakroom provide comfort and practicality for everyday living and entertaining.
The upper floor is dedicated to the villa’s most private quarters, hosting three double bedrooms with built-in wardrobes that enjoy open views over the swimming pool and grounds. The principal suite, approximately 49 m² in size, is particularly noteworthy with its generous proportions, abundant natural light, and refined design. Floor-to-ceiling windows open onto a private 41 m² terrace overlooking the pool and gardens. This suite also features built-in wardrobes, a fireplace, an elegant lounge area with minibar, and a bright en-suite bathroom with a walk-in shower and double vanity.
Among the property’s outstanding amenities is a magnificent 123 m² swimming pool, a wellness area comprising a sauna and jacuzzi, and solar panels to enhance energy efficiency. The outdoor areas are designed for the Mediterranean way of life, featuring a covered terrace with an outdoor dining area, barbecue, and traditional wood-fired oven — ideal for entertaining family and friends. Additional features include a garage for two vehicles and ample storage space. While the villa is in excellent condition, it also presents significant refurbishment potential, allowing its future owner to create a contemporary luxury residence and increase its value in this sought-after location. Buying property in Spain
Spain welcomes foreign buyers with no nationality restrictions. The buyer needs an NIE (Número de Identidad de Extranjero) before completion, and most buyers open a Spanish bank account to handle the deposit and ongoing charges. An independent lawyer (abogado) is strongly recommended — the notario only checks the deed, not the wider title.
- 1
Get an NIE
Apply for the foreign-resident tax number at a Spanish consulate, police station, or via a representative with power of attorney.
- 2
Open a Spanish bank account
Needed for the deposit, taxes, mortgage payments, and utilities.
- 3
Engage an independent lawyer
Lawyer runs title, debts, planning, and community-of-owners checks — the notario will not.
- 4
Reservation contract
Small deposit (€3,000–€10,000) takes the property off the market while due diligence runs.
- 5
Sign the contrato de arras
Private purchase contract with a 10% deposit. If the buyer pulls out they lose it; if the seller pulls out they pay double.
- 6
Sign the escritura pública
Final public deed signed before a notario; balance and taxes paid; keys handed over.
- 7
Register the property
Lawyer registers the deed at the Registro de la Propiedad and arranges utility and IBI transfers.
Spain ended its Golden Visa property route in April 2025. Non-resident mortgages are widely available, typically 60–70% LTV. Non-resident sellers face a 3% withholding from the sale price (retención), claimable against capital gains tax. Always check community-of-owners (comunidad) debts and outstanding IBI before completion — they transfer with the property.
